Why These Are the Top Plumbing Contractors in Sarles

** The plumbing market serving Sarles, ND is characterized by a reliance on established contractors from larger nearby towns, primarily Langdon (~25 miles away) and Devils Lake (~60 miles away). Due to the rural nature of the area, competition is limited but the available providers are generally high-quality, family-owned businesses with strong local reputations built over decades. Service calls to Sarles may involve travel fees, and scheduling for non-emergency services can sometimes require advance booking due to the wide geographic areas these companies cover. The level of service is typically very personal and reliable. Pricing is generally competitive for the region, reflecting the travel distance and the specialized skills required for rural plumbing systems, which often include well water and septic systems.
